Seventeen-year-old Nafisa Abdullah Aminu from Yobe State, Nigeria, has made her country proud by clinching the top spot in English language skills at the 2025 TeenEagle Global Finals.

The prestigious competition, which took place in London, United Kingdom, saw thousands of bright minds from around the world vying for top honors in various academic and communication challenges.

Nafisa emerged victorious among a pool of over 20,000 students representing 69 countries. Her outstanding performance not only showcased her mastery of the English language but also highlighted the potential of Nigerian students on the global stage.

Her win has sparked celebration and admiration across Nigeria, as she becomes a source of inspiration for many aspiring young scholars.
